Update org.apache.karaf.services.coordinator in subsystem feature

Hi,

I have noticed that the subsystem feature [1] contains
the org.apache.karaf.services.coordinator/4.x which references
org.eclipse.equinox.coordinator
[2] which is dated back to 2012. In the transaction and jpa feature the
newer up-to-date felix version [3] is being used.

The version at [2] is a little buggy from what I have seen. I experienced a
lot of concurrency issues when using it as well as an issue related to the
embedding of the jar [4]. Should this reference be updated to the felix
version or is there any particular reason for subsystems to use the equinox
version?
